- Notice of Intent to Sole Source -
F3GTFC6169A001 - DRT Custom Training Course
The 99th Contracting Squadron intends to award a sole source Purchase Order under the authority of FAR 13.106-1(b)(1) due to supplies or services required by the agency being available from only one responsible source and no other type of supplies or services will satisfy agency requirements. The requirement is for the purchase of a 5-day DRT Custom Training Course for JCER personnel.
This notice of intent is not a request for competitive proposals and no solicitation document exists for the requirement. Sources interested in responding to this notice are required to submit a capability statement that includes technical data and cost information, sufficient detail and with convincing evidence that clearly demonstrates the capability to meet the requirement. All capability statements received by the due date of this notice will be considered by the Government.
A request for documentation or additional information or submissions that only ask questions will not be considered as an affirmative response. A determination by the Government not to compete based on responses to this notice is solely within the discretion of the Government. Information received will be considered solely for the purpose of determining whether to conduct a competitive procurement or to proceed with a sole source procurement.
Capability statements are due on 14 August 2026 by 10:00 AM Pacific Time. To ensure your response along with any and all attachments are received, attachment(s) must be less than 10 MB [in total]. It is the responsibility of the offeror to contact the government to confirm receipt prior to the offer due date and time. Capability statements shall be submitted by email ONLY as a Microsoft Word or Adobe PDF attachment to the following address:
